Experimental investigation of photovoltaic panel surface temperature at various tilt angles

Abstract

By growing the population of the world, the demand for clean and renewable energy resources is increasing, because fossil energy sources available are limited. Solar energy is a sustainable energy source which is widely accessible. Photovoltaic systems are utilized to generate electrical energy from solar radiation. Photovoltaic panel temperature is a major parameter that influence its effectiveness. Decreasing photovoltaic temperature could be rise its performance. In this work, Photovoltaic panel surface temperature has been measured at various tilt angles. This data research consists of time-depending photovoltaic module and tedlar temperature values with climatic characteristics of the test region. In the experimental section, photovoltaic panel were placed at 30°, 32° and 34° tilt angles. Temperature values were obtained from the front glass and tedlar foil. The main goal of this study is investigating the influence of tilt angle on photovoltaic temperature which could be used in numerical works such CFD simulation.
